- Contents:
- Spangenberg, A. G. Journal of a journey to Onondaga in 1745.
- Cammerhoff, Brother. Diary of the journey of Br. Cammerhoff and David Zeisberger to the Five Nations from May 4-14 to August 6-17, 1750.
- Mack, J. M. Diary of J. Martin Mack's, David Zeisberger's, and Gotfried Rundt's journey to Onondaga in 1752.
- Zeisberger, D. and Frey, H. Diary of David Zeisberger's and Henry Frey's journey and stay in Onondaga from April 23d to November 12th, 1753.
- Frederick, C. and Zeisberger, D. Diary of a journey to Onondaga, residence there, and return from thence, from June 9, 1754, to June 4, 1755.
- Zeisberger, D. Journey to Cayuga, spring of 1766.
- Zeisberger, D. and Sensemann, G. Journey to Onondaga and Cayuga, October, 1766.
